The Origins of Pragmatism

Pragmatism as a philosophical motion emerged in the United States during the late 19th century, primarily through the works of thinkers such as Charles Sanders Peirce, William James, and John Dewey. These thinkers were dissatisfied with the standard metaphysical and epistemological frameworks that dominated Western approach and sought to establish a more useful and dynamic method to understanding the world.

  1. Charles Sanders Peirce: Often credited as the founder of pragmatism, Peirce presented the idea that the significance of a concept is figured out by its useful impacts. He argued that fact is not an outright however is rather a hypothesis that can be checked and customized based on its results.

  2. William James: James popularized pragmatism and extended its concepts to psychology and ethics. He stressed the importance of experience and the practical consequences of beliefs and actions. For James, the worth of a belief depends on its capability to produce favorable results.

  3. John Dewey: Dewey used pragmatism to education and social reform. He thought that discovering need to be an active, experiential process and that social organizations must be created to promote useful solutions to real-world issues.

The Core Principles of Pragmatism

Pragmatism is assisted by several essential principles that shape its technique to analytical and decision-making:

  1. Action-Oriented: 프라그마틱 무료 슬롯버프 Pragmatism is essentially action-oriented. It prioritizes what can be done over what ought to be done, focusing on useful steps that cause concrete results.

  2. Empiricism: Pragmatists stress the importance of empirical evidence and 프라그마틱 슬롯 무료체험 real-world experience. They think that knowledge is originated from observation and experimentation, not from a priori thinking.

  3. Versatility: Pragmatism is naturally flexible. It encourages individuals to adjust their methods and beliefs based upon changing situations and brand-new details.

  4. Problem-Solving: Pragmatism is fixated solving issues. It looks for to find the most reliable and efficient options, often by combining varied viewpoints and approaches.

  5. Contextual Understanding: Pragmatists recognize that context matters. They examine ideas and actions based on the specific situation in which they are applied, rather than on universal principles.

The Challenges of Pragmatism

While pragmatism offers numerous advantages, it likewise deals with challenges and criticisms. A few of these include:

  1. Lack of Vision: Critics argue that pragmatism's concentrate on immediate results can lead to an absence of long-term vision. Without a clear direction, companies may have a hard time to achieve sustainable growth.

  2. Ethical Concerns: Pragmatism's emphasis on outcomes can in some cases result in ethical compromises. It is important to stabilize usefulness with moral concepts to make sure that decisions are both efficient and ethical.

  3. Short-Term Thinking: A pragmatic method can in some cases prioritize short-term gains over long-lasting advantages. It is essential to consider the long-lasting ramifications of actions to prevent unintentional consequences.

  4. Resistance to Change: While pragmatism values versatility, it can be challenging to encourage people and companies to alter their methods. Resistance to brand-new ideas and approaches can impede the adoption of pragmatic options.
